    Series 2A-2: Multiple stressor experiments on T. pseudonana (CCMP1014) – photophysiology
    (Biological and Chemical Oceanography Data Management Office (BCO-DMO). Contact: bco-dmo-data@whoi.edu, 2020-11-30) Passow, Uta ; Laws, Edward ; Sweet, Julia
    These experiments were designed to test the combined effects of temperatures and light intensity on the growth growth rate (mu) and photophysiology of the diatom Thalassiosira pseudonana CCMP 1014 in a multifactorial design. Experiments were conducted in artificial seawater supplemented with 5% sterilized seawater. Six temperatures (13.5°C, 20°C, 25°C, 29°C, 31°C, and 32.5°C), and eight light intensities (25, 50, 80, 115,190, 300, 400 and 600 µmol photons · m-2 · s-1 ) were tested during the course of these experiments. This dataset contains measurements of photophysiology using the Light curve (LC3) protocol of the Aquapen-C AP-C 100 fluorometer.     Series 1B-3: Multiple stressor experiments on T. pseudonana (CCMP1335) – computed data from the LC3 protocol for samples at 4 temperatures, 15-26C
    (Biological and Chemical Oceanography Data Management Office (BCO-DMO). Contact: bco-dmo-data@whoi.edu, 2020-11-30) Passow, Uta ; Laws, Edward ; Sweet, Julia
    Four follow-up experiments on the combined effect of light and temperature changes on the growth rate (mu) and photophysiology of Thalassiosira pseudonana CCMP 1335 were conducted to supplement / repeat series 1A experiments. This was necessary because doubt existed regarding the growth during 1A experiments. 1A experiments were conducted in artificial seawater. 1B experiments were conducted in artificial seawater supplemented with 5% sterilized seawater. The experiments were designed to test the combined effects of four temperatures, and eight light intensities on the growth and photophysiology of the diatom T. pseudonana CCMP1335 in a multifactorial design. This dataset contains measurements of photophysiology using the Light curve (LC3) protocol of the Aquapen-C AP-C 100 fluorometer.
